火炬之光2运行报错的常见原因与专业分析
《火炬之光2》作为一款经典的动作角色扮演游戏,凭借其丰富的剧情和流畅的打击感深受玩家喜爱。然而,许多玩家在运行游戏时频繁遭遇报错、闪退或卡顿问题,严重影响体验。这些问题的根源通常与系统兼容性、显卡驱动版本、游戏文件完整性以及后台进程冲突相关。例如,Windows 10/11系统可能因默认设置不兼容旧版DirectX组件导致运行异常;过时的显卡驱动则可能无法支持游戏图形渲染,从而触发崩溃。此外,第三方软件(如杀毒工具或录屏程序)占用过多资源时,也可能导致游戏卡顿或报错。本节将深入解析这些问题的成因,为后续解决方案提供理论支持。
全面解决火炬之光2运行报错的六大步骤
步骤1:调整兼容性设置与管理员权限
右键点击游戏主程序(通常为Torchlight2.exe),选择“属性”并进入“兼容性”标签页。勾选“以兼容模式运行此程序”,建议选择Windows 7或Windows 8模式。同时启用“以管理员身份运行此程序”,确保游戏拥有必要的系统权限。此操作可解决80%因系统更新导致的兼容性问题。
步骤2:更新显卡驱动与DirectX组件
访问NVIDIA、AMD或Intel官网下载最新显卡驱动,安装后重启电脑。对于DirectX问题,可通过微软官方工具“DirectX End-User Runtime”修复缺失组件。建议同时安装Visual C++ Redistributable套件(2010-2022版本),确保游戏依赖库完整。
步骤3:验证游戏文件完整性
Steam用户可右键游戏库中的《火炬之光2》,选择“属性”→“本地文件”→“验证游戏文件完整性”。GOG或Epic平台用户需通过客户端内置修复功能完成检测。此操作能自动替换损坏或丢失的DLL文件及资源包。
步骤4:关闭冲突后台进程
按下Ctrl+Shift+Esc打开任务管理器,结束高资源占用的非必要进程(如杀毒软件、浏览器、流媒体服务)。建议使用“游戏模式”或专用优化工具(如Razer Cortex)自动释放内存与CPU资源。
步骤5:修改游戏配置文件
定位至“我的文档\My Games\Runic Games\Torchlight 2”文件夹,用记事本打开settings.txt。调整以下参数: - FULLSCREEN : 0 (窗口化模式降低显存压力) - VSYNC : 1 (开启垂直同步防止画面撕裂) - MAXFPS : 60 (限制帧率避免GPU过热)
步骤6:禁用全屏优化与覆盖程序
在游戏主程序的属性页面中,勾选“禁用全屏优化”。同时关闭Steam、Discord等平台的游戏内覆盖功能(Steam设置→游戏中→取消启用Steam覆盖),可显著减少因叠加界面导致的渲染冲突。
高级优化:针对特定错误代码的解决方案
若报错提示包含特定代码(如0xc000007b、d3dx9_43.dll缺失),需针对性处理: - **错误0xc000007b**:使用DirectX修复工具4.0增强版,勾选“修复C++”与“修复API Sets”; - **dll文件缺失**:从微软官网下载对应版本的DirectX 9.0c完整包并安装; - **PhysX报错**:为N卡用户安装最新PhysX系统软件,A卡用户则需在游戏设置中关闭物理加速功能。 对于MOD引发的崩溃,建议逐一排查MOD兼容性,或清空“PAKS”文件夹后重新验证游戏文件。
硬件与系统环境深度优化指南
长期稳定运行《火炬之光2》需确保硬件符合最低要求(双核2.0GHz CPU/4GB内存/NVIDIA GeForce 8800显卡)。建议执行以下深度优化: 1. 在NVIDIA控制面板/AMD Radeon设置中,为游戏单独分配高性能GPU; 2. 使用Display Driver Uninstaller彻底卸载旧驱动后重新安装; 3. 开启Windows游戏模式(设置→游戏→游戏模式)并禁用Game Bar; 4. 为游戏安装目录添加杀毒软件白名单,防止误删关键文件。 若仍存在卡顿,可尝试降低阴影质量、抗锯齿等级,或使用第三方优化工具(如CPUCores)进一步释放系统资源。